DESCRIPTION

Webster City, Iowa is home to a large development opportunity for one or more distribution centers. We have 223 acres available fronting Highway 20 (a four lane highway) that is 15 minutes from Interstate 35. Highway 20 is a major east-west corridor, moving traffic between Sioux City, Iowa (west) and Dubuque, Iowa (east). We've got incentives available for job creation and the site has utilities stubbed to the property boundary with sufficient capacity to support large development. Page 6: Distribution center opportunity

Property Specifics

• 223 contiguous acres

• 6 parcels, 2 owners

• Max slope < 2 %

• Current use: agriculture

• Zoning: M1 Light Industrial

• Max Bldg Height: 50 ft

• Price: 25,000/acre

• Ample utility capacity

• Less than ½ mile to access

Highway 20

• Site plan: 7 to 10 days

• Building permits: 5 to 7 days

• Incentives: 2 to 8 weeks

Approvals

Page 10: Distribution center opportunity

Utility Information

• Water, sewer and electric provided

by municipal utility

• Natural gas provided by Black Hills

Energy

Water

• 12” main exists 13 feet from

eastern property line

• 62 PSI, 1210 gpm, 2.0 mgd

capacity

Sewer

• 10” main exists 97 feet from

eastern property line

• 700 gpm, 1.5 mgd capacity

Electric

• 69 kV overhead with 3 phase

available 66 feet from property line

• 15 MW of existing capacity

Utilities
